11/13/1 List: Beat Drinks


Barry Benintende's 10 drinks with named after the Beat Generation.

"The Kerouac"
Two shots of Vodka, one shot grapefruit juice,
shaken and served with a lime wedge.

"A.Ginsburg"
Equal parts red wine and prune juice.
Served over ice.

"The Happy Cassady"
3 shots bourbon
a dash of lime juice
a dash of 7 Up

"The Burroughs"
2 shots of espresso
3 shots of Irish whiskey
served hot.

"The Subterranean"
1 cup of strawberries
1 cup of whipping cream
6 shots tequila
4 shots dark rum

"The Karlo Marx"
1/4 oz Light rum
1/4 oz Dark rum
1/2 oz Amaretto
1/2 oz Peach schnapps
2 oz Orange juice
1 splash 7 Up
Mix in a large drinking glass, serve over ice.

"The Desolation Angel"
1 shot Jack Daniels
2 shots Vodka
6 shots Dr. Pepper
1 dash Sugar
1 piece Cherry

"The Howler"
2 cups Vodka
4 cups Pineapple juice
4 cups Cranberry juice
64 oz Ginger ale
2 cups Sugar
Ice

"The Beat"
3 parts Becherovka
3 parts Rum
1 part Blue Curacao
5 parts Orange juice
Tonic water
Shake. Garnish with an orange twist and a cherry.

"The Mexico City Blues"
6 oz Red wine
1 oz Coca-Cola
4 oz Tequila
1 oz Blue Curacao
3 oz Orange juice
3 tblsp Banana, chopped
1 cup Raisins
6 oz Champagne (Dom Perignon)
1/2 tsp Hot red pepper flakes
    Heat vine, add raisins and boiled. Mix Coca-Cola, tequila, orange juice,
Blue Curacao and add to boiled vine with raisins.
Toss bananas with hot red pepper flakes. Pour Don Perignon over bananas. Mix
everything together and store in a glass jar.
Put in a fridge for 8 hours. Served chilled with fresh cherries.
